Provides therapeutic services and psychological evaluations to patients of varying ages within assigned department. This includes but is not limited to individual, group, and family therapy, diagnostic interviews and assessments, the administration and interpretation of psychological tests and coordination of treatment services for the patient. Percentage of time spent in psychological testing, psychotherapy and other specific job duties may vary between individual psychologists.Work Experience:
2 years of supervised clinical experience in psychological health services of which at least 1 year is post-doctoral and one year (may be the post-doctoral year) is in an organized psychological health service training program OR Listing in the National Register of Health Service Providers in Psychology.
Education Qualifications:
A doctoral degree in psychology from a regionally accredited university.
